What is Espresso?

Espresso is a concentrated coffee that originated in Italy. It is made by forcing hot water through finely ground coffee beans under high pressure. The result is a rich, smooth, and robust coffee with a layer of crema on top.

Espresso is the base for many coffee drinks, such as cappuccinos, lattes, and Americanos. It is a popular choice for coffee lovers who want a quick pick-me-up or a strong caffeine boost.

How to Make Espresso at Home?

Making espresso at home is easier than you might think. Here are the steps:

  1. Grind your coffee beans. You will need about 7-8 grams of coffee per shot of espresso. Use a burr grinder to achieve a fine grind.
  2. Preheat your espresso machine. This will ensure that your espresso is brewed at the right temperature.
  3. Fill the portafilter basket with the ground coffee. Level the coffee and tamp it down using a tamper. The coffee should be evenly distributed and tamped down firmly.
  4. Lock the portafilter into the espresso machine and start brewing. The espresso should take about 25-30 seconds to brew. The end result should be a shot of espresso with a layer of crema on top.
  5. Enjoy your espresso shot as is or use it as a base for other coffee drinks.

What Kind of Coffee do I Need for Espresso?

The coffee you use for espresso should be a medium to dark roast. It should also be freshly roasted and freshly ground. Avoid using pre-ground coffee as it can be stale and lose its flavor quickly.

Look for coffee beans that are specifically labeled for espresso. These beans are usually a blend of different coffee varieties that are chosen for their flavor profile and ability to create a rich and creamy espresso.

What Equipment do I Need to Make Espresso at Home?

To make espresso at home, you will need an espresso machine and a burr grinder. There are many types of espresso machines available on the market, ranging from manual to fully automatic. Choose a machine that fits your budget and brewing preferences.

A burr grinder is essential for achieving a fine and consistent grind for your espresso. Avoid using a blade grinder as it can create an uneven grind that will affect the flavor of your espresso.

How to Properly Tamp Espresso?

Tamping is an important step in making espresso as it helps to ensure that the coffee is evenly distributed and compacted in the portafilter basket. Here are the steps for tamping:

  1. Fill the portafilter basket with ground coffee.
  2. Level the coffee using your finger or the edge of a flat object.
  3. Hold the tamper with your dominant hand and place it on top of the coffee.
  4. Apply downward pressure with your arm and tamp the coffee down firmly.
  5. Remove the excess coffee from the edges of the portafilter using a clean cloth or your finger.
